Benjamin Giles, Commissioner of the Government of the State Queensland for Indonesia, emphasized that tafe queensland was the largest vocational education institution and the oldest in the state, with 150,000. Campus.
He explained that Tafe focused on skills and industrial experience education, including in the field of sports administration and training.
"We are very open to expand this cooperation, including in the exchange of students and the development of the sports curriculum," said Giles. Students will get the experience of sports training and professional sports training classes in various branches. []
